Hyderabad: Not far away from the city’s renowned art galleries, a painter is roaming the lanes of Kukatpally, turning the walls of almost every building and rock formations in the locality into his own gallery of art, that too with a purpose.
Jagadish, who ekes out a living by painting buildings, is adorning the rocks and walls in Yellamma Banda with giant images and slogans, accompanied with contemporary awareness messages like ‘wear a mask’, ‘maintain physical distance’ and ‘use soap and sanitisers’. All this — for no profit or revenue.
“Actor Sonu Sood is my inspiration. I am amazed by the work he is doing in these tough times. I too wanted to do my bit and nothing can make a lasting expression on people’s minds other than art. So, I’m putting my skill to good use,” he says.
It has been 15 days since he picked up his brush and started painting walls and so far, has painted nearly every wall in the locality apart from 10 rocks. “I can’t afford another lockdown, which will not happen until and unless every citizen takes steps to protect themselves and others. We need to break the chain. I can see many people every day without a mask or wearing one at the chin. Since it is easier to catch the attention of the people through art, I thought why not start this initiative,” he adds.
Though Jagadish doesn’t earn anything from this, the entire initiative is being funded by himself, and even then, he says it is satisfying. “Many passers-by appreciate my art. The paintings have different messages which are delivered creatively. This is my contribution to society,” he adds.
